The Edmond J. Safra Synagogue, located on the Upper East Side of Manhattan, has served as a vibrant community hub for Torah learning and cultural events since its establishment in March 2003. Offering various religious services and educational programs, the synagogue fosters a welcoming environment for members and guests from around the world.
